"departmental T-shirt, 2410"
 
   Many departments of the IPO follow a tradition, originally absorbed from the Utopia Planitia Naval Shipyards project office, of creating and distributing special employee T-shirts every now and then. Some are intended to commemorate particular projects or occasions undertaken by the department; others are just meant as declarations of membership, as it were.

The crime lab is no exception. Here is the department's "members only" shirt design for 2410 - except that, being the crime lab, they had their design put on the backs of lab coats.

Of special note is the limited edition created for the people in the serology/DNA lab, on which the "blood spatter" is:

a) white
b) fluorescent under ALS
c) glow-in-the-dark
